计算机二级c语言如何准备考试

计算机二级c语言如何准备考试

计算机二级C语言考试准备指南

计算机二级C语言考试的准备,需要了解考试大纲、系统学习基础知识、针对性练习题目、掌握编程技巧、利用模拟考试提高实战能力。其中,系统学习基础知识是重中之重。C语言作为一门基础编程语言,其语法和逻辑是计算机编程的核心,系统地学习C语言的基础知识能够帮助考生更好地理解和应用编程技巧,从而在考试中取得理想成绩。下面将从多个方面详细介绍如何准备计算机二级C语言考试。

一、了解考试大纲

1、考试内容概览

考试大纲是备考的指南针,了解考试内容和要求是备考的第一步。计算机二级C语言考试主要包括以下几个部分:C语言基础知识、程序设计方法与技巧、数据结构与算法、系统函数与库函数使用、编程实践。考生应根据大纲的内容逐一进行学习和掌握。

2、重点与难点分析

每个考试部分都有其重点和难点。C语言基础知识部分重点在于变量、数据类型、运算符和表达式、控制结构等内容;程序设计方法与技巧部分侧重算法设计和模块化编程;数据结构与算法部分则主要考查数组、链表、栈、队列等数据结构的实现和应用;系统函数与库函数使用部分考查字符串处理、文件操作等常用函数的使用;编程实践部分主要通过具体的编程题目考查考生的综合应用能力。考生应根据自己的实际情况,有针对性地进行复习。

二、系统学习基础知识

1、C语言语法基础

C语言的语法是编程的基础,考生应掌握变量定义和初始化、基本数据类型和运算符、控制结构(如if语句、switch语句、for循环、while循环等)、函数定义和调用等基本语法知识。掌握这些语法知识不仅有助于解决具体问题,还能帮助考生更好地理解高级编程技巧。

2、数据结构与算法基础

数据结构与算法是C语言编程的重要组成部分。考生应掌握常见数据结构(如数组、链表、栈、队列等)的基本概念和操作方法,了解常用算法(如排序算法、查找算法等)的实现原理和应用场景。通过学习数据结构与算法,考生能够更好地解决复杂的编程问题,提高编程效率。

三、针对性练习题目

1、选择题练习

选择题部分主要考查考生对C语言基础知识的掌握情况。考生可以通过做选择题练习,巩固基础知识,熟悉考试题型,提高应试能力。建议考生每周定期做一定数量的选择题,并对错题进行总结和分析,找出薄弱环节,进行针对性复习。

2、编程题练习

编程题是计算机二级C语言考试的重点和难点。考生应通过做编程题练习,掌握编程技巧,提高编程能力。建议考生每天至少做一道编程题,逐步提高编程水平。对于一些难度较大的题目,可以参考他人的解题思路,但不要完全依赖,应尽量独立完成。

四、掌握编程技巧

1、代码规范与调试

良好的代码规范能够提高代码的可读性和可维护性,考生应养成良好的编程习惯。代码调试是编程过程中不可避免的一环,考生应掌握常用的调试方法和工具,能够快速定位和解决代码中的错误。

2、常用算法与设计模式

掌握常用算法和设计模式有助于提高编程效率和代码质量。考生应熟悉一些常见的算法(如排序算法、查找算法、递归算法等)和设计模式(如单例模式、工厂模式、观察者模式等),并能够在实际编程中灵活应用。

五、利用模拟考试提高实战能力

1、模拟考试的重要性

模拟考试是考生检验复习效果、提高应试能力的重要手段。通过模拟考试,考生可以熟悉考试环境和流程,找到自己的不足之处,进行针对性调整和改进。建议考生在备考的最后阶段,每周进行一次模拟考试,逐步提高考试能力。

2、模拟考试的实施

模拟考试应尽量模拟真实考试环境,严格按照考试时间和要求进行。考试结束后,考生应对试卷进行认真分析和总结,找出自己的不足之处,进行针对性复习。对于一些难度较大的题目,可以参考他人的解题思路,但不要完全依赖,应尽量独立完成。

六、参考书籍与学习资源

1、推荐书籍

《C程序设计语言》:由C语言的发明者Brian W. Kernighan和Dennis M. Ritchie合著,是学习C语言的经典教材。书中内容详实,例题丰富,适合初学者学习。

《数据结构与算法分析》:由Mark Allen Weiss所著,是学习数据结构与算法的经典教材。书中内容详实,例题丰富,适合有一定编程基础的考生学习。

《计算机二级C语言考试指导》:针对计算机二级C语言考试的专门辅导书,内容涵盖考试大纲的各个方面,适合考生进行系统复习。

2、在线学习资源

MOOC(慕课):如中国大学MOOC、Coursera等平台上有许多免费的C语言课程,考生可以根据自己的实际情况选择合适的课程进行学习。

编程练习平台:如LeetCode、牛客网等平台上有许多编程题目,考生可以通过做题练习,提高编程能力。

在线编程工具:如在线GDB、IDEOne等平台提供在线编译和调试功能,考生可以在这些平台上进行编程练习。

七、学习计划与时间管理

1、制定学习计划

科学的学习计划是备考成功的关键。考生应根据考试大纲和自身实际情况,制定详细的学习计划,合理安排学习时间和内容。建议考生每天至少安排2小时进行C语言学习,逐步提高编程水平。

2、时间管理技巧

高效的时间管理有助于提高学习效率。考生应养成良好的学习习惯,避免拖延和分心。可以采用番茄工作法(Pomodoro Technique),即每学习25分钟休息5分钟,保持高效的学习状态。

八、应试技巧与心理准备

1、应试技巧

考试时,考生应合理分配时间,先易后难,避免在某一道题目上花费过多时间。对于选择题,考生应仔细阅读题目,排除错误选项,提高答题准确率。对于编程题,考生应先理清思路,逐步实现,避免犯低级错误。

2、心理准备

良好的心理状态有助于发挥最佳水平。考生应保持积极乐观的态度,避免焦虑和紧张。考试前一天,应保证充足的睡眠,考试当天提前到达考场,避免因迟到而影响考试状态。

九、复习总结与查漏补缺

1、复习总结

在复习过程中,考生应定期进行总结,梳理知识点,找出自己的不足之处,进行针对性复习。可以通过做笔记、画思维导图等方式,帮助记忆和理解知识点。

2、查漏补缺

通过做题和模拟考试,考生可以找到自己的薄弱环节,进行针对性复习。对于一些难点和重点内容,考生应多加练习,确保掌握。

十、考前准备与考试注意事项

1、考前准备

考前一周,考生应对考试大纲进行全面复习,梳理知识点,确保知识点的掌握。考前一天,应准备好考试所需的证件和文具,确保考试顺利进行。

2、考试注意事项

考试时,考生应仔细阅读题目,合理分配时间,避免在某一道题目上花费过多时间。对于选择题,考生应仔细阅读题目,排除错误选项,提高答题准确率。对于编程题,考生应先理清思路,逐步实现,避免犯低级错误。

十一、考后的总结与提升

1、考后总结

考试结束后,考生应对考试过程进行总结,找出自己的不足之处,进行针对性提升。可以通过做笔记、画思维导图等方式,帮助记忆和理解知识点。

2、持续学习

通过考试只是学习的一个阶段,考生应保持持续学习的态度,不断提高自己的编程水平。可以通过参加编程比赛、做项目等方式,提升自己的编程能力。

十二、项目管理工具的使用

1、研发项目管理系统PingCode

PingCode是一款专业的研发项目管理系统,适合团队协作和项目管理。通过PingCode,考生可以管理自己的学习计划和任务,提高学习效率。

2、通用项目管理软件Worktile

Worktile是一款通用的项目管理软件,适合个人和团队使用。通过Worktile,考生可以管理自己的学习计划和任务,提高学习效率。

通过以上十二个方面的详细介绍,相信考生可以更好地准备计算机二级C语言考试。祝愿考生在考试中取得优异成绩!

相关问答FAQs:

Q1: 如何准备计算机二级C语言考试?

  • A1: 考前复习是准备考试的关键。建议首先复习C语言的基础知识,包括语法、数据类型、运算符等。然后,通过做一些练习题来巩固理解和提高编程能力。还可以参考一些教材或在线教程,深入学习一些高级的C语言知识,如函数、指针、结构体等。

Q2: 考前有哪些备考技巧可以分享?

  • A2: 在备考过程中,有几点技巧可以帮助你更好地准备考试。首先,合理安排复习时间,制定一个详细的复习计划,并坚持执行。其次,多做一些真题和模拟题,了解考试的题型和难度,有针对性地复习相关知识。还可以组织一个学习小组或找一个学习伙伴,互相讨论和解答问题,共同进步。

Q3: 如何提高解题速度和准确性?

  • A3: 提高解题速度和准确性需要一定的练习和技巧。首先,熟练掌握C语言的基本语法和常用函数,这样在解题过程中可以更快地写出正确的代码。其次,多做一些编程练习,通过不断练习可以提高编程思维和解题能力。另外,注意理解题目要求,分析问题并合理利用已有的知识和技巧,可以更快地找到解题思路。最后,多注意排查代码中的错误,避免低级错误对解题造成影响。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/1288597

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部